The FBI identified the suspect as Shamsud-Din Jabbar, a 42-year-old U.S. citizen from Texas. Witnesses described the chaos as a pickup truck plowed through revelers on Bourbon Street around 3:15 a.m. It was a night meant for joy. Yet, it morphed into a nightmare in an instant.
This act has now been classified as terrorism. Authorities discovered an apparent ISIS flag inside the truck, which raises troubling questions. What drove Jabbar to commit such an act? Speculations swirl as the FBI continues their investigation.
Details are emerging. Weapons and potential IEDs were found in Jabbar’s vehicle, leaving us on edge. Local police are collaborating with FBI bomb technicians. Their priority: ensuring the area is secured and safe.
During a press conference, officials stated that Jabbar likely did not act alone. This element amplifies our fears. Do we know everything about this attack, or is there more to uncover? The FBI urges anyone with information to step forward.
Jabbar had a criminal history but nothing that pointed to such violent behavior. In Katy, Texas, he faced minor charges, including theft and driving violations. It’s hard to reconcile that background with the act of terror he committed.

New Orleans Police Superintendent, Chief Anne Kirkpatrick, emphasized the deliberate nature of the act. ‘This was not a DUI situation. This man was intent on creating chaos.’ Such remarks underscore the severity of the event and raise pressing questions: Are we safe?
